R E S O L U T I O N
 1-1           WHEREAS, The 60th wedding anniversary of two notable Texans
 1-2     is indeed an occasion worthy of special praise and recognition, and
 1-3     on September 11, 1997, Bennie and Evelyn Allen of Bryan will
 1-4     celebrate one such remarkable event; and
 1-5           WHEREAS, A World War II veteran, Mr. Allen worked in the
 1-6     fields of construction, aviation, and education before returning to
 1-7     his first occupation, ranching, and he has brought his
 1-8     characteristic energy and determination to each of these endeavors
 1-9     in turn; and
1-10           WHEREAS, Mrs. Allen has likewise distinguished herself as a
1-11     vital and valued member of the community, and is active in a number
1-12     of organizations, including the A&M Garden Club, of which she is a
1-13     past president, and the Brazos Valley Art League; a gifted
1-14     musician, she often performs for the residents of the Sherwood
1-15     Nursing Home, the University Hills Nursing Home, and the Brazos
1-16     Valley Geriatric Center; and
1-17           WHEREAS, Devoted members of the Church of Christ, Mr. and
1-18     Mrs. Allen have drawn strength and spiritual sustenance from their
1-19     fellow worshipers, and their presence in the congregation is a
1-20     welcome one; and
1-21           WHEREAS, Throughout the years, Mr. and Mrs. Allen have
1-22     derived their greatest joy and satisfaction from their large and
1-23     loving family, and they take great pride in their son and
1-24     daughter-in-law, Melvin Allen and Kathy Allen; their daughter and
 2-1     son-in-law, Patricia Ann Allen Howard and Eudean Howard; their
 2-2     grandchildren, Sonja Allen Holder, Brandon Benjamin Allen, Ashley
 2-3     Allen, Michelle Howard Tarhini, Dean Allen Howard, Brent Howard,
 2-4     and Patrick Howard; and their great-grandchildren, Sarah Tarhini,
 2-5     Chad Tarhini, and Ross Tarhini; and
 2-6           WHEREAS, For 60 years, Bennie and Evelyn Allen have enjoyed a
 2-7     relationship that continues to grow in mutual regard and affection,
 2-8     and it is indeed fitting at this time to celebrate their life
 2-9     together; now, therefore, be it
2-10           RESOLVED, That the Texas House of Representatives of the 75th
2-11     Texas Legislature hereby congratulate Benjamin A. Allen and Evelyn
2-12     Lois Pullen Allen on the occasion of their 60th wedding anniversary
2-13     and extend to them sincere best wishes for continued success and
2-14     happiness in the years to come; and, be it further
2-15           RESOLVED, That an official copy of this resolution be
2-16     prepared for Mr. and Mrs. Allen as an expression of high regard by
2-17     the Texas House of Representatives.
